Firm Capital Purchases Interest In Thickson Place Retail Centre

Thickson Place in Whitby, ON

Firm Capital Property Trust has acquired a 40% stake in Thickson Place, a 105k SF retail centre in Whitby, ON, from First Capital Realty for $15.8M. The deal grows Firm Capital’s portfolio by 11%, to $157M. Thickson Place is 100% occupied, anchored by Metro and LCBO and across from Whitby Mall, another retail property in which Firm Capital owns a 40% interest, alongside the same JV partners (a syndicate group controls 10%). Both malls are managed by First Capital, and Firm Capital says its ownership of the neighbouring centres will provide long-term synergies.
